Agent runs in background on dev machines, compares local env state against team baseline at commit time. Flags version mismatches, missing services, config deltas before push. Slack/terminal alert. $15/seat/mo.
Real pain. Build is non-trivial (OS differences). TAM is developer teams — solid but niche. Needs WTP validation in r/devops.

Willingness to Pay
Dev teams paying $20-50/seat on Doppler, Teleport, Spacelift for env management. Drift detection is a gap in all of them. $15-25/seat/mo positioned as pre-CI safety layer.

10/15Existing Solutions
Doppler (secrets, not drift), Spacelift (infra drift, not local dev), Devbox/Nix (complex setup). No lightweight local dev drift detector with alerting.
